Course Details

Air Law Fundamentals: An introduction to the basic principles of air law, including its sources, subjects, and key concepts.

Air Navigation and Communication: A study of the rules and regulations governing air navigation and communication, including air traffic control, airspace classification, and communication procedures.

Aircraft Registration and Certification: Examination of the requirements for registering and certifying aircraft, including the role of national aviation authorities and international organizations.

Air Transport Operations: Analysis of the legal framework governing air transport operations, including passenger rights, cargo regulations, and liability for damages.

Aviation Safety and Security: Investigation of the legal and regulatory aspects of aviation safety and security, including accident investigation, security protocols, and emergency response procedures.

Air Law Case Studies: Review and analysis of real-world air law cases, exploring the legal issues, arguments, and outcomes in depth.
